INTRODUCTIONThe technique of laryngoscopy consists of proper positioning, opening of the mouth, inserting the laryngoscope blade, positioning it in the valleculla and applying force to raise the epiglottis and then insert the endo-tracheal tube through the vocal cords into the trachea. One of the most teleological functions of the larynx is that of airway protection, which is primarily provided by means of glottic closure reflex Apart from the airway, this process induces various changes in different physiological systems of the body.
Laryngoscopy and intubation are an intense noxious stimulus for the body. Among the various systems, of importance is the cardio vascular system, wherein the response occurs via the vagal and the glossopharyngeal afferents that result in a reflex autonomic activation. This manifests as reflex tachycardia and hypertension in adults and adolescents, whereas autonomic activation in children and infants results in reflex bradycardia.
The heart rate and blood pressure are known to fluctuate in the post intubation period. Another parameter is the Rate–pressure product (RPP), it was originally described by Katz & Feinberg (1958) as an index of ‘cardiac effort’ and correlation with oxygen consumption was confirmed in humans by Kitamura et al. (1972). RPP is linearly correlated with oxygen consumption. It is of equal importance in cardiac compromised patients.
Studies have also established that the magnitude of cardiovascular response is related to the force applied to lift the glottis and the duration of laryngoscopy. All this being established for patients with no co-morbidities present, the knowledge regarding the changes in cardiovascular parameters are of absolute necessity in case any co morbidity factors are present. For example, hypotension is relatively common in patients with poor LV function, hypertension may be induced due to sympathetic stimulation during laryngoscopy; following the stress of tracheal intubation kidney transplant patients may develop hypotension before surgical incision.The resultant sympathetic response and the resulting hemodynamic response have been extensively studied and documented in different patient groups, both with and without cardiac illness.
The choice of anesthetic techniques should be selected while keeping the patient’s cardiac patho-physiology and other co-morbid conditions in mind.No single set ‘algorithm’/’recipe’ can guarantee hemodynamic stability during anesthetic induction.
The purpose of the present study is to compare the hemodynamic changes using three different devices, namely the new VLSCOPE (video laryngoscope), Light wand and the conventional Macintosh laryngoscope for as an intubating in elective adult surgical patients.
Video laryngoscopy is relatively recent development that improves the success of tracheal intubation. They have revolutionized the practice of airway, and are now included in the ASA “Difficult Airway Algorithm†as an alternative approach to intubation. Numerous studies have already been performed and in place to compare and evaluate the physiological altercations caused by the newer instruments in the ever evolving field of airway management.
MATERIAL AND METHODS
Elective endotracheal intubation will be carried out in adult sugrical patients using VLSCOPE (video laryngoscope), Light wand and conventional Macintosh laryngoscope in 30 patients in each group.
Haemodynamcis derrangements in terms of heart rate, mean arterial blood pressure and rate pressure product shall be recoded and are the primary objectives of this study. Furthermore, secondary objectives that include time for intubation, success rate, number of attempts, number of adjustment maneuvers for successfull intubation, ease of intubation, any incidence of airway trauma or any post operative sore throat shall also recorded.
The results will be compared amongst the three groups.
